Palapye Guesthouse is registered with the Botswana Tourism Organisation as a guest house with 17 rooms, which makes it larger than most properties carrying that licence class. Like Palapye Hotel it appears on the register but not on the international booking channels.

Palapye, and why it is on this site
Palapye sits on the A1 between Gaborone and Francistown, at the junction for Serowe and the Khama Rhino Sanctuary. It is a coal and university town rather than a tourist one, and almost all of its accommodation is built for contractors, students’ families and people driving the eastern corridor.
For travellers it is a useful place to break the drive, and it is the obvious base for a Khama Rhino Sanctuary visit if you would rather not camp. Several of its properties appear only on the national register and never on a booking channel.
